Message processing method and apparatus, electronic device, storage medium, and program product
US-2024388548-A1 · Nov 21, 2024 · US
US2016330146A1 · US · A1
| Field | Value |
|---|---|
| Publication number | US-2016330146-A1 |
| Application number | US-201615145297-A |
| Country | US |
| Kind code | A1 |
| Filing date | May 3, 2016 |
| Priority date | May 8, 2015 |
| Publication date | Nov 10, 2016 |
| Grant date | — |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A method of facilitating electronic communication of a message between a plurality of accounts including a first account and a plurality of outside accounts may include determining if a number of the plurality of accounts or a ratio of the plurality accounts that approve an anonymous mode is greater than or equal to a first reference value based on first voting information received from the plurality of accounts, converting the mode of a chat room to the anonymous mode by matching each of a plurality of temporary accounts with a respective one of the plurality of accounts, if the determining determines that the number of the plurality of accounts or the ratio of the plurality accounts is greater than or equal to the first reference value; and displaying the message from an account in the chat room with an indication of the temporary account associated with the account.
Opening claim text (preview).
1 . A method of facilitating electronic communication of at least a first message between a plurality of accounts including a first account and a plurality of outside accounts, the method comprising: receiving a request to convert a mode of a chat room to an anonymous mode; receiving first voting information from the plurality of accounts, the first voting information indicating whether a user associated with a respective one of the plurality of accounts approves the anonymous mode; determining if a number of the plurality of accounts or a ratio of the plurality accounts that approve the anonymous mode is greater than or equal to a first reference value based on the first voting information; converting the mode of the chat room to the anonymous mode by matching each of a plurality of temporary accounts with a respective one of the plurality of accounts, if the determining determines that the number of the plurality of accounts or the ratio of the plurality accounts is greater than or equal to the first reference value; and displaying the first message from an account in the chat room with an indication of the temporary account associated with the account, if the first message is received from one of the plurality of accounts. 2 . The method of claim 1 , further comprising: creating the chat room such that the chat room facilitates the communication of the first message between the plurality of accounts. 3 . The method of claim 1 , further comprising: redistributing the plurality of temporary accounts, if a new account joins the chat room. 4 . The method of claim 3 , wherein the redistributing comprises: releasing a correspondence relationship between the plurality of accounts and the plurality of temporary accounts; increasing a number of the plurality of temporary accounts; and matching each of the new account and the plurality of accounts with respective ones of the plurality of temporary accounts. 5 . The method of claim 1 , further comprising: determining whether one of the plurality of accounts exits the chat room; and setting a new correspondence relationship between each of the plurality of accounts remaining in the chat room and the plurality of temporary accounts, if one of the plurality accounts exits the chat room. 6 . The method of claim 1 , further comprising: receiving a request to terminate the anonymous mode from any one of the plurality accounts; and converting the mode of the chat room to a general mode, if the receiving receives the request to terminate the anonymous mode such that, in the general mode, when the chat service providing apparatus receives a second message from a transmitting accounting of the plurality of accounts, the chat service providing apparatus displays the second message along with an indication of the transmitting account in the chat room. 7 . The method of claim 6 , wherein the converting comprises: receiving second voting information from the plurality of accounts, the second voting information indicating whether a user associated with a respective one of the plurality accounts approves terminating the anonymous mode; determining if a number of the plurality of accounts or a ratio of the plurality accounts that approve termination of the anonymous mode is greater than or equal to a second reference value based on the second voting information; and terminating the anonymous mode, if the determining determines that the number of the plurality of accounts or the ratio of the plurality accounts is greater than or equal to a second reference value. 8 . The method of claim 7 , wherein the terminating comprises: terminating the anonymous mode after a first reference time period elapses after receiving the request to terminate the anonymous mode. 9 . The method of claim 6 , further comprising: receiving one or more parameters from the one of the plurality accounts requesting termination of the anonymous mode, the one or more parameters including at least one of a duration time of the anonymous mode and whether to disclose which of the plurality of users generated the first message in the anonymous mode when the anonymous mode is terminated. 10 . The method of claim 1 , wherein, the determining comprises: incrementing the number of the plurality of accounts that approve the anonymous mode based on the plurality of accounts that do not provide the first voting information within a second reference time. 11 . The method of claim 1 , wherein, the determining comprises: incrementing a number of the number of the plurality of accounts that disapprove the anonymous mode based on the plurality of accounts that do not provide the first voting information within a second reference time. 12 . The method of claim 1 , wherein the converting comprises: at least one of generating and receiving the plurality of temporary accounts and an indication of which of the plurality of temporary accounts correspond to the plurality of accounts. 13 . The method of claim 1 , wherein, the converting converts the plurality of accounts to the plurality of temporary accounts such that each of the plurality of temporary accounts is in a one-to-one correspondence with each of the plurality of outside accounts and the first account, and the displaying displays the first message in the chat room such that an indication of the temporary account associated with the account that transmitted the first message is displayed in the chat room. 14 . The method of claim 1 , wherein the displaying displays the first message in the chat room such that the first message and subsequent messages created by other ones of the plurality of accounts are aligned in the same direction on each of user terminals associated with the plurality of accounts. 15 . A non-transitory computer readable recording medium having recorded thereon a program, which when executed by a computer, performs the method defined in claim 1 . 16 .- 20 . (canceled) 21 . A method of communicating messages in an instant messaging environment, the method comprising: anonymizing the instant messaging environment by, generating a number of unique temporary accounts, assigning each of a plurality of users within the instant messaging environment with one of the unique temporary accounts, and associating the messages from each of the plurality of users with respective ones of the unique temporary accounts; and displaying the messages in the instant messaging environment such that a source of each of the messages is indicated with the respective ones of the unique temporary accounts. 22 . The method of claim 22 , wherein the anonymizing anonymizes the instant messaging environment in response to a request to switch the instant messaging environment to an anonymous mode from one of the plurality of users. 23 . The method of claim 22 , further comprising: tallying a first approval rate amongst the users to switch to the anonymous mode; determining if the first approval rate is above a threshold; anonymizing the instant messaging environment, if the first approval rate is greater than or equal to the threshold; and maintaining an identified mode in which the source of each of the messages is indicated as a respective one of the plurality of users, if the first approval rate is less than the threshold. 24 . The method of claim 22 , further comprising: re-anonymizing the instant messaging environment, if a new user joins the instant messaging environment operating in the anonymous mode, the re-anony
Terminal devices · CPC title
Network architectures or network communication protocols for network security (cryptographic mechanisms or cryptographic arrangements for secret or secure communication H04L9/00; network architectures or network communication protocols for wireless network security H04W12/00; security arrangements for protecting computers or computer systems against unauthorised activity G06F21/00) · CPC title
Real-time or near real-time messaging, e.g. instant messaging [IM] · CPC title
Network arrangements for conference optimisation or adaptation · CPC title
Anonymous communication, i.e. the party's identifiers are hidden from the other party or parties, e.g. using an anonymizer ·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.